標題:
物件導向基礎概念 (二)
[打印本頁]
作者:
葉桔良
時間:
2023-4-22 15:24
標題:
物件導向基礎概念 (二)
定義一 Family 類別,並在Family類別下建立四個實體物件,分別為man、woman、boy 與 girl。同時,於Family類別下定義 showProfile() 方法用來顯示每位家庭成員的描述,並於 main 方法中呼叫它。
執行參考畫面如下:
本帖隱藏的內容需要積分高於 1 才可瀏覽
作者:
錢冠叡
時間:
2023-4-22 17:22
主程式
package Test9;
public class Ch99 {
public class Ch03 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
Family dad=new Family("爸爸",40,"爬山");
dad.showProfile();
Family mom=new Family("媽媽",37,"逛街");
mom.showProfile();
Family boy=new Family("男孩",10,"打電動");
boy.showProfile();
Family girl=new Family("女孩",8,"看書");
girl.showProfile();
}
}
class family
{
String n;
int y;
String h;
family(String name,int years,String hobby)
{
n=name;
y=years;
h=hobby;
}
void showProfile()
{
System.out.println(n+"今年幾"+y+"歲,喜歡"+h+".");
}
}
}
複製代碼
fAMILY
package Test9;
public class Family {
int age;
String Name,hobby;
Family(String n,int a,String h)
{
age = a;
Name = n;
hobby = h;
}
void show()
{
System.out.println(Name + "今年" + age + "歲,喜歡" + hobby);
}
public void showProfile() {
// TODO Auto-generated method stub
}
}
複製代碼
作者:
柏霖
時間:
2023-4-22 17:22
main
public class Ch05 {
public static void main(String[] args) {
family man=new family("爸爸", 40 , "爬山");
man.show();
family woman=new family("媽媽", 37 , "逛街");
woman.show();
family boy=new family("男孩", 10 , "打電動");
boy.show();
family girl=new family("女孩", 8 , "看書");
girl.show();
}
}
複製代碼
family
public class family
{
int age;
String Name, Hobby;
family(String n, int a, String h)
{
age=a;
Name=n;
Hobby=h;
}
void show()
{
System.out.println( Name+"今年"+age+"歲,喜歡"+Hobby);
}
}
複製代碼
作者:
許浩浩
時間:
2023-4-22 17:30
public class Ch02 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
Family man=new Family("爸爸",40,"爬山");
man.show();
Family woman=new Family("媽媽",37,"逛街");
woman.show();
Family boy=new Family("男孩",10,"打電動");
boy.show();
Family mann=new Family("女孩",8,"看書");
mann.show();
}
}
複製代碼
public class Family {
int age;
String name,hobby;
Family(String n, int a, String h)
{
age=a;
name=n;
hobby=h;
}
void show()
{
System.out.println(name+"今年"+age+"歲, 喜歡"+hobby);
}
}
複製代碼
作者:
張駿霖
時間:
2023-4-22 17:30
主程式:
public class Ch01 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
Family man = new Family("爸爸",40,"爬山");
man.show();
Family woman = new Family("媽媽",37,"逛街");
woman.show();
Family boy = new Family("男孩",40,"爬山");
boy.show();
Family girl = new Family("女孩",37,"逛街");
girl.show();
}
}
Family:
public class Family {
int age;
String Name, hobby;
Family(String n, int a, String h)
{
age=a;
Name=n;
hobby=h;
}
void show()
{
System.out.println(Name+"今年"+age+"歲,喜歡"+hobby);
}
}
複製代碼
作者:
孫文康
時間:
2023-4-22 17:30
Ch01
public class Ch01 {
public static void main(String[] args) {
Family man=new Family("爸爸",40,"爬山");
man.show();
Family woman =new Family("媽媽",37,"逛街");
woman.show();
Family boy =new Family("男孩",10,"打電動");
boy.show();
Family girl =new Family("女孩",8,"看書");
girl.show();
}
}
複製代碼
Family
public class Family {
int age;
String Name,hobby;
Family (String n,int a,String h)
{
age=a; Name =n; hobby=h;
}
void show()
{
System.out.println(Name+"今年"+age+"歲,喜歡"+hobby);
}
}
複製代碼
作者:
謝閔丞
時間:
2023-4-22 17:32
主程式
package b;
public class Ch01 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
family man = new family("爸爸",40,"爬山");
man.show();
family woman = new family("媽媽",37,"逛街");
woman.show();
family boy = new family("男孩",10,"打電動");
boy.show();
family girl = new family("女孩",8,"看書");
girl.show();
}
}
複製代碼
family
package b;
public class family {
int age;
String Name, hobby;
family(String n,int a,String h)
{
age = a;
Name = n;
hobby = h;
}
void show()
{
System.out.println(Name+"今年"+age+"歲,喜歡"+hobby);
}
}
複製代碼
作者:
石皓云
時間:
2023-4-22 17:37
主程式
public class Ch01 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
f man=new f("爸爸",40,"玩手機");
man.show();
f mom=new f("媽媽",37,"看書");
mom.show();
f my=new f("我",11,"打電動");
my.show();
f girl=new f("妹妹",7,"看電視");
girl.show();
}
}
複製代碼
f
public class f {
int age;
String Name,hobby;
f(String n,int a,String h){
age=a;
Name=n;
hobby=h;
}
void show(){
System.out.println(Name+"今年"+age+"歲,喜歡"+hobby);
}
}
複製代碼
作者:
侯宣任
時間:
2023-4-24 21:13
package Test9;
public class Ch99 {
public class Ch03 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
Family dad=new Family("爸爸",40,"爬山");
dad.showProfile();
Family mom=new Family("媽媽",37,"逛街");
mom.showProfile();
Family boy=new Family("男孩",10,"打電動");
boy.showProfile();
Family girl=new Family("女孩",8,"看書");
girl.showProfile();
}
}
class family
{
String n;
int y;
String h;
family(String name,int years,String hobby)
{
n=name;
y=years;
h=hobby;
}
void showProfile()
{
System.out.println(n+"今年幾"+y+"歲,喜歡"+h+".");
}
}
}
複製代碼
fAMILY
package Test9;
public class Family {
int age;
String Name,hobby;
Family(String n,int a,String h)
{
age = a;
Name = n;
hobby = h;
}
void show()
{
System.out.println(Name + "今年" + age + "歲,喜歡" + hobby);
}
public void showProfile() {
// TODO Auto-generated method stub
}
}
複製代碼
作者:
侯宣仲
時間:
2023-4-24 21:31
public class Ch01 {
public static void main(String[] args) {
// TODO 自動產生的方法 Stub
f man=new f("爸爸",40,"玩手機");
man.show();
f mom=new f("媽媽",37,"看書");
mom.show();
f my=new f("我",11,"打電動");
my.show();
f girl=new f("妹妹",7,"看電視");
girl.show();
}
}
複製代碼
public class Family {
int age;
String name,hobby;
Family(String n, int a, String h)
{
age=a;
name=n;
hobby=h;
}
void show()
{
System.out.println(name+"今年"+age+"歲, 喜歡"+hobby);
}
}
歡迎光臨 種子論壇 | 高雄市資訊培育協會學員討論區 (http://istak.org.tw/seed/)
Powered by Discuz! 7.2